I did not know I was dyslexia throughout my K-12 experience. In fact I was bullied because that was called the dumb student and I stumbled onto my dyslexia when I was in college. And so I went from a D student to being on the dean's list once I got the help that I needed. But the significant part about it is that I knew that I would never beat you with brilliance. I'm going to beat you with endurance. I'm not going to surrender. The dark moment of not being able to learn was not. It turned out to be a blessing.
